Etymology

edit

Coined from Hawaiian ka (the) + moʻo (fragment) + a (of) + lewa (to jump, to oscillate), referring to a fragmentary object that oscillates in the sky from the perspective of Earth.

Kamoʻoalewa

  1. (astronomy) 469219 Kamoʻoalewa, a small Apollo asteroid and quasi-satellite of Earth. It may be an impact fragment from the Moon.
